A metrology device incorporates a programmable smart card. The smart card may be a Java programmable smart card and allows the metrology device to access Java applications and resources while still retaining independent control over its metrological functions. A smart card interface allows the smart card and metrological device to communicate with each other using the ISO 7816 protocol. Automated methods and apparatus for synchronizing audio and text data, e.g., in the form of electronic files, representing audio and text expressions of the same work or information are described. A statistical language model is generated from the text data. A speech recognition operation is then performed on the audio data using the generated language model and a speaker independent acoustic model. Silence is modeled as a word which can be recognized. A sample stream having a fixed sampling rate, representing a filtered version of an input symbol stream is produced by a pulse shaping and resampling device of the present invention. The pulse shaping/resampling device can be used as part of a digital modulator. Methods and apparatus for automatically generating a set partition adjustment renormalization rate (SPARR) threshold used to determine correct or incorrect set partition synchronization in a trellis decoder as a function of a renormalization rate are described. The invention makes use of the inventor's observation that when the system is properly synchronized, the rate of growth of cumulative error sums closely corresponds to an accumulation of minimum set partition errors. Methods and apparatus for reducing the total amount of memory required to implement a video decoder and to perform a scan conversion operation on decoded video are described. In accordance with the present invention this is accomplished by having an interlaced to progressive (I-P) conversion circuit utilize the same frame memory used to decode the images upon which a conversion operation is performed. Methods and apparatus for providing speech recognition capability to callers in a cost efficient manner as part of one or more telephone services are described. Multiple speech recognition units with differing capabilities and therefore implementation costs are provided. Calls are assigned to speech recognition circuits throughout a call based on a signal such as a service type identifier indicating the type of service to be provided to the caller. A receiver arranged to receive and store broadcast data transported by elementary stream of a multiplexed and modulated digital television signal in a rewritable memory during a low power consumption mode for later recall by a user of the receiver. For recall, the receiver is fully energized, and the receiver is further arranged to transfer the broadcast data stored in the rewritable memory to a receiver storage device for further processing of the data under control of the user.
